The Xiaomi Redmi Note 12 4G is designed with both aesthetic appeal and functionality in mind. Featuring dimensions of 165.7 x 76 x 7.9 mm and weighing 183.5 g, this smartphone strikes a balance between being lightweight and robust. Built with a glass front protected by Gorilla Glass 3, a plastic frame, and a plastic back, the device offers durability while maintaining a sleek look. The dual-SIM capability further enhances its usability for those who manage multiple numbers.
The phone is equipped with a stunning 6.67-inch AMOLED display that boasts a resolution of 1080 x 2400 pixels, offering vibrant colors and deep contrasts. With a 120Hz refresh rate, users enjoy smooth scrolling and an enhanced gaming experience. The display supports 450 nits (typ), 700 nits (HBM), and 1200 nits (peak) brightness levels, ensuring visibility even under direct sunlight. The screen’s ~85.3% screen-to-body ratio enhances the immersive viewing experience.
The Redmi Note 12 4G's triple-camera setup includes a 50 MP wide lens, an 8 MP ultrawide lens, and a 2 MP macro lens. This versatile combination allows users to capture a wide range of scenes, from expansive landscapes to detailed close-ups. Features like LED flash, HDR, and panorama add flexibility to photography. The device supports video recording at 1080p@30fps. The 13 MP front-facing camera, also capable of HDR and 1080p recording, ensures detailed selfies and video calls.
Driven by the Qualcomm SM6225 Snapdragon 685 chipset and an Octa-core CPU, the Redmi Note 12 4G handles multitasking and demanding applications with ease. The Adreno 610 GPU enhances the gaming experience by delivering smooth graphics. Available in models with varying RAM and storage combinations (4-8GB RAM, 64-256GB storage), the device offers options for different usage requirements. The presence of a microSDXC card slot provides further storage expansion capabilities. Running on Android 13, it is upgradable to Android 14 with HyperOS, offering a seamless and customizable user experience.
Featuring a robust 5000mAh non-removable Li-Po battery, the Redmi Note 12 4G ensures extended usage without frequent recharges. It supports 33W wired charging, allowing for quick power-ups. This setup provides an endurance rating of 117 hours, as per tests, ensuring that users can rely on the device throughout the day for various tasks.
The device supports multiple connectivity options, including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ac, Bluetooth 5.0, and USB Type-C 2.0 with OTG support. It also includes NFC capabilities, although availability is market dependent, and an infrared port for remote functionalities. The phone caters to audio enthusiasts with its loudspeaker system and a 3.5mm headphone jack. Positioning technologies like GPS, GLONASS, and GALILEO aid in accurate location tracking.
Compatible with GSM, HSPA, and LTE networks, the Redmi Note 12 4G ensures reliable connectivity across various regions. It supports a wide range of frequency bands, including 2G, 3G, and several 4G LTE bands, allowing for versatile usage worldwide. The device offers fast data speeds with HSPA and LTE capabilities.

In performance testing, the device demonstrated impressive results with an AnTuTu score of 319219 (v9) and GeekBench scores of 1797 (v5.1) and 1341 (v6). The GFXBench reported a performance of 7.5fps for ES 3.1 onscreen, indicating capable graphics handling. The sound quality is evaluated as good, with a rating of -27.9 LUFS for the loudspeaker performance.
